How to Remove the Trunk Partition of Mercedes-Benz GLA?

6Answers
McReid
07/29/2025, 08:14:49 PM

Method for removing the trunk partition of Mercedes-Benz GLA: 1. Press the raised rubber strip on the partition and push it to the left. 2. Then remove the partition. There are springs at the connection points for easy removal. Below is more information about the Mercedes-Benz GLA: 1. The Mercedes-Benz GLA is a model positioned between the new A-Class and the GLA concept car, with body dimensions of 4410mm in length, 1834mm in width, and 1611mm in height, and a wheelbase of 2729mm. 2. The Mercedes-Benz GLA is equipped with two turbocharged engines: a 1.6T and a 2.0T. The 1.6T engine has a maximum power of 156 horsepower and a maximum torque of 250 Nm; the 2.0T engine has different power outputs, with maximum power of 184 horsepower and 211 horsepower, and maximum torque of 300 Nm and 350 Nm, respectively.

Removing the trunk partition board of the Mercedes-Benz GLA is actually quite simple. I've done it myself several times. First, empty the trunk to make it easier to operate, then fold down the rear seats to create space. There are fixing devices on both sides of the partition board, and you need to find the rotating buttons or clips hidden in the slots. I remember there's a round knob on the left side—turning it 90 degrees clockwise will release it, while the right side usually has a plastic clip that you press and push toward the center. When removing it, use one hand to support the bottom of the partition to prevent it from falling, and use the other hand to operate the clip. After removing it, don’t just toss it onto the trunk floor—place it vertically against the side or take it home for safekeeping, otherwise it will rattle while driving. The whole process takes about ten minutes. Just remember to use gentle force and avoid forcing the plastic parts—even a woman can handle it easily.

The design of the Mercedes-Benz GLA's trunk partition is quite user-friendly, as it can be removed without tools. First, pay attention to both ends of the partition where it meets the inner walls of the trunk. On the left, there's usually a knob with an arrow, and on the right, a square clip. When removing it, I first lift the partition slightly to disengage its latch from the top rail. Then, I turn the left knob half a turn to loosen it, while on the right side, I press the protruding part inward and lift it up. It might be a bit stiff when pulling it out, so just wiggle it gently. The partition itself has some weight, so it's best to have two people work together to remove it. By the way, for storage, the Mercedes trunk side walls have dedicated hook slots—perfect for hanging less frequently used items to save space. After removal, you'll notice the rear seats fold down to create significantly more space, making it super convenient for transporting large luggage.

I'm familiar with this. I used to frequently remove the GLA's partition board when loading camping gear. The key is to check the connection points where the partition meets the trunk: on the left side, it's a rotating buckle structure – look for the gray knob and turn it 180 degrees; the right side usually has press-release tabs, just find the protrusion and push it in. Before removal, remember to gently push the partition towards the rear of the car to help disengage the plastic hooks more easily. Avoid using excessive force throughout the process, as Mercedes' buckles are prone to cracking. The removed partition can be folded or separated into two sections, fitting perfectly in the gap behind the seats. If it gets stuck, don't yank forcefully – check if the spare tire cover is catching the edge. Occasionally applying some grease to the buckles will make future removals smoother.

To remove the divider panel, focus on the two main fixation points on both sides—rotate the left side and push the right side. Here's the step-by-step: First, clear any clutter in the trunk to prevent scratches if the panel falls. Turn on the trunk light for better visibility. The left side features a rotary latch—locate the disc with grooves and turn it counterclockwise to unlock. The right side has a hidden tab; slide your fingers into the panel gap to feel a raised bump, press inward while lifting the panel upward. Always support the panel during removal to avoid dropping and damage. Since the panel material scratches easily, wear cloth gloves. Pro tip: Removal is easiest in summer heat when plastic softens, or in winter, pre-warm the area with car heater first.

This job isn't difficult, just follow three steps: locate the clips, release the locks, and gently remove the storage panel. The clips are positioned at both ends of the panel against the side walls—rotate the left knob about 90 degrees and press the right button all the way down. Before removal, fold up the trunk mat to prevent it from catching on the panel's lower edge, and remember to detach any metal hooks. The removed panel remains intact and can be separated into two sections or folded for storage. After removing the panel in my car, the view became much clearer, making reversing with rear window visibility easier. Note: some GLA model years have panels with safety straps—don't yank them off; they fit perfectly in the trunk mesh pocket. Bonus tip: when washing the car, avoid spraying water directly at the clip areas to prevent water accumulation, rust, and jamming.

How Long is the Lifespan of the M274 Engine?

M274 engine can last up to 300,000 kilometers if used and maintained properly. The introduction and maintenance methods of the M274 engine are as follows: Introduction to the M274 Engine: The M274 engine is a longitudinally mounted modular platform, available in two displacements: a 1.6T turbocharged engine and a 2.0T turbocharged engine. The M274 engine incorporates Mercedes' variable valve lift technology, which is designed not to increase power but to reduce emissions and meet higher environmental standards. Maintenance Methods for the M274 Engine: When the engine is running, the oil forms a protective film on the surfaces of various components, preventing direct friction between them. Therefore, it is essential to monitor the oil condition regularly and change the oil at scheduled intervals.

What to Do When the Car Battery Dies and the Car Won't Start?

Solutions for when the car battery dies and the car won't start: 1. Push-starting can be used as an emergency measure, though this only applies to manual transmission vehicles; 2. Jump-starting by borrowing another car's battery with jumper cables; 3. Using a portable emergency power bank to charge and start the car. A car battery, also known as a storage battery, is a type of battery that works by converting chemical energy into electrical energy. Car batteries are categorized into conventional lead-acid batteries, dry-charged batteries, and maintenance-free batteries. Typically, when people refer to a car battery, they mean a lead-acid battery. The normal service life of a car battery ranges from 1 to 8 years, depending largely on the vehicle's condition. Taking conventional lead-acid batteries as an example, their plates are made of lead and lead oxide, with the electrolyte being an aqueous solution of sulfuric acid. The main advantage of these batteries is stable voltage, while the disadvantages include low specific energy (the amount of electrical energy stored per kilogram of battery), short service life, and frequent maintenance requirements.

What is the difference between allroad and avant?

Here are the differences between allroad and avant: 1. Different appearance: (1) Allroad is more like a lowered SUV with higher ground clearance, protruding wheel arches, and roof rails. (2) Avant looks more like a hatchback version of the Audi A6. 2. Different configurations: (1) Allroad comes standard with a four-wheel drive system and features adaptive air suspension. The Allroad mainly uses a 3.0L supercharged engine. (2) The entry-level Avant adopts a front-wheel-drive design, and only the high-end version has four-wheel drive. The Avant starts with a 1.8T engine.
